India and Greece Near Agreement on Migration and Mobility, says PM Modi

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Greek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is are close to finalizing a partnership on migration and mobility. During a meeting in New Delhi, Modi expressed happiness over doubling bilateral trade by 2030 and welcomed Greece's participation in the Indo-Pacific. The leaders discussed collaborations in startups, shipping, defence, cybersecurity, and education. India and Greece plan to celebrate their 75th diplomatic anniversary with a joint action plan in science, technology, sports, and more. Mitsotakis affirmed support for India's UN Security Council bid. The visit marks the first bilateral head of state visit from Greece to India in 15 years.
